Hi Y'all,

Is the steering column cover on a 70 srl, the one that covers the ignition switch assembly, a clam shell style? is it removable with out removing the steering wheel? i know removing the safety bolts on the rear wont be a problem but i don't want to ruin the cover either.

Thanks in advance

Yes. There are tiny phillips screws going upwards to the upper half of the shell. You can find the screw access on the bottom half.
I want to say there are three screws.
